What is Springboard Hospitality?

Springboard Hospitality is a hotel management company that operates and manages independent and boutique hotels across the United States. The company specializes in providing services such as property management, marketing, revenue management, and guest experience optimization. With a portfolio of unique properties, Springboard Hospitality focuses on innovative hospitality solutions tailored to each hotel's specific needs. Their expertise helps hotel owners maximize profitability and deliver memorable guest experiences.

Primary mission:

You will clean and maintain all corridors and public areas in accordance with all housekeeping procedures and standards and safety and security rules and regulations to ensure guest satisfaction.

SCOPE OF WORK + TEAM

  • Reports to the Director of Housekeeping/Housekeeping Manager
  • Supports housekeeping team

R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Walk all assigned floors at beginning and end of shift; remove newspapers and service trays, empty ash urn receptacles, remove trash and/or linens and note any areas that need immediate cleaning.
  • Clean all public areas in the prescribed manner while following safety and security procedures and regulations to include but not limited to: hallways, elevators, service areas, stairwells, etc...
  • Remove soiled linen, terry and trash from the service areas and take to the appropriate locations in the prescribed manner. Must be able to lift, push, pull at least 50 lbs.
  • Aid section housekeepers as needed (i.e. bed boards, roll-ways, etc.).
  • Report any missing/found articles, damage or merchandise problems to the Housekeeping Supervisor.
  • Receive assigned section, keys, supplies and any priority requests from the Senior Housekeeper.
  • Be able to communicate and respond at all times, in a friendly, helpful and courteous manner to guests, managers and fellow associates. Report all guest issues and complaints to management
  • Coordinate with Senior Housekeeper on work priorities and provide assistance when needed.
  • Perform special projects and other responsibilities as assigned
